    What is a Portable Physiotherapy Laser?

    So, what exactly is a portable physiotherapy laser? In essence, it's a compact, handheld device that emits low-level laser light, also known as cold laser or low-level laser therapy (LLLT). Unlike surgical lasers that cut through tissue, these lasers stimulate cellular activity, promoting healing and reducing pain. The beauty of a portable device lies in its convenience; you can use it at home, at the gym, or even while traveling. This accessibility makes consistent treatment much easier to achieve, leading to better outcomes. The device works by delivering photons of light to the body's tissues, which are then absorbed by cells. This absorption triggers a series of biological reactions, including increased ATP production (the cell's energy currency), enhanced blood flow, and reduced inflammation. Think of it as giving your cells a boost to repair themselves more efficiently.

    How to Choose the Right Portable Physiotherapy Laser

    Choosing the right portable physiotherapy laser can feel overwhelming, but with a little guidance, you can find the perfect device to meet your specific needs. First, consider the laser's power output. Higher power lasers typically deliver faster results, but they may also be more expensive. Lower power lasers are gentler and may be more suitable for sensitive areas or individuals with lower pain tolerance. Next, think about the wavelength of the laser. Different wavelengths penetrate to different depths in the body, so the ideal wavelength will depend on the condition you're treating. For example, longer wavelengths are better for deep tissue injuries, while shorter wavelengths are more effective for superficial skin conditions.

    Safety Tips for Using a Portable Physiotherapy Laser

    When using a portable physiotherapy laser, safety should always be your top priority. While these devices are generally safe, it's important to follow certain guidelines to minimize the risk of injury or adverse effects. First and foremost, always wear protective eyewear when using the laser. The laser light can be harmful to your eyes, so it's essential to shield them with the provided safety glasses. Never point the laser directly at your eyes or anyone else's eyes. Next, read the user manual carefully before using the device. Familiarize yourself with the controls, treatment protocols, and safety precautions. This will help you use the laser safely and effectively.

    Avoid using the portable physiotherapy laser on areas of the body that are cancerous or suspected of being cancerous. Laser therapy can stimulate cellular activity, which could potentially accelerate the growth of cancerous cells. Also, do not use the laser on pregnant women or individuals with pacemakers without consulting with a healthcare professional. While there is no definitive evidence that laser therapy is harmful in these situations, it's always best to err on the side of caution. If you have any underlying health conditions, such as diabetes, epilepsy, or a bleeding disorder, talk to your doctor before using a portable physiotherapy laser. They can help you determine if the treatment is safe for you and provide guidance on any necessary precautions.

    Furthermore, start with a low power setting and gradually increase it as tolerated. This will help you avoid overstimulating the tissues and causing discomfort. If you experience any pain, redness, or irritation during or after treatment, stop using the laser and consult with a healthcare professional.
